What's the difference between the 3G series and the XLc series Lightspeed Headsets?

Other than the obvious change in the color scheme, there are a few different features on the LightSpeed 3G series that are not on the LIghtspeed XLc series. The 3G-battery box has a more ergonomic tear drop shape. The XLc battery box has a rectangular design. The battery box on the 3G also has a side tone equalizer (i.e. a bass and/or treble boost) that allows people to choose what sounds best to them. Another difference is the ear seal. On the 3G we have changed the outer coating to a leather-like material and increased the size of the ear opening. The internal foam remains the same as the XL, for that well-known comfortable fit. In the XLc series, we use a separate speaker for voice and the active noise reduction. The 3G series has a single speaker, dual driver system. With this system there is a noticeable upgrade in audio fidelity and intelligibility.
